Ticket: DRIFT-legacy token refresh weirdness (Korvane auth)

Hey on-call — session-token refresh keeps failing on prod-east only. Turns out someone hand-edited the refresh window on that box months ago and it never made it back into the repo, classic drift. Tokens expire before the refresh fires, users get bounced. Fix is to realign prod-east with the canonical values, which for the record are these.

settings of fafog-haduf:
ZORIX_PIN=4648
ZORIX_METRICS_HOST=metrics.zorix.paliqsys.corp
ZORIX_LOG_LEVEL=info
ZORIX_TENANT=druix

// REINDEX_BATCH_CAP limits docs per shard pass in the Tallowfield
// nightly search reindex. Raising it starves the ingest queue;
// lowering it overruns the maintenance window. 5000 is the tested
// sweet spot. Change only with a soak run. Verified against the
// build noted below.

session token of bawif-hahog = htk6_ac5981

**Ticket SUP-4471: Tailgrep vault sealed**

Support team: the credential vault backing Tailgrep, our internal log-tailing CLI, sealed itself after the Fennbrook cluster restart early this morning. Users running `tailgrep follow` will see authentication errors until it's unsealed. Please verify the vault host is healthy, confirm no unseal attempts are in flight, and note your actions in the shift log. Then unseal the vault using the recovery passphrase below.

recovery phrase for baweg-faweg: zorael-framir

## Who to ping about GiftNote

Welcome aboard! GiftNote is our donation-receipt mailer for the Larchfield Fund. Template tweaks go to the comms folks; delivery failures and bounce weirdness go to the platform crew. Don't push template changes on Fridays — receipts batch over the weekend. For anything GiftNote-related, start with the address below.

billing contact of kaweg-tajeg = drudor.lamion.oliath@torvalabs.test

**Mgmt Meeting Minutes — Retiring the Brightline Range**

Quick recap for sales leads at Fenholt Supplies: we agreed to retire the Brightline fixture range by year-end. Remaining stock moves to clearance pricing next month, and accounts on standing orders get migrated to the Lumetta range. Trade-in incentives were approved in principle. The confidential note on next steps sits just below.

board note of bajof-bajeg: The pricing group signed off on a budget of $13.4 million for Project Sildor. The renewal with Lamixek Holdings closes at $48.9 million a year, 49 percent above the last contract.